How to Install and Uninstall x2goserver-desktopsharing.x86_64 Package on Oracle Linux 9

Last updated: May 06,2024

1. Install "x2goserver-desktopsharing.x86_64" package

Please follow the guidelines below to install x2goserver-desktopsharing.x86_64 on Oracle Linux 9

$ sudo dnf update $ sudo dnf install x2goserver-desktopsharing.x86_64

2. Uninstall "x2goserver-desktopsharing.x86_64" package

Please follow the steps below to uninstall x2goserver-desktopsharing.x86_64 on Oracle Linux 9:

$ sudo dnf remove x2goserver-desktopsharing.x86_64 $ sudo dnf autoremove

3. Information about the x2goserver-desktopsharing.x86_64 package on Oracle Linux 9

Last metadata expiration check: 2:01:47 ago on Thu Feb 15 07:50:05 2024.
Available Packages
Name : x2goserver-desktopsharing
Version : 4.1.0.3
Release : 17.el9
Architecture : x86_64
Size : 53 k
Source : x2goserver-4.1.0.3-17.el9.src.rpm
Repository : epel
Summary : X2Go Server (Desktop Sharing support)
URL : http://www.x2go.org
License : GPLv2+
Description : X2Go is a server based computing environment with
: - session resuming
: - low bandwidth support
: - session brokerage support
: - client side mass storage mounting support
: - audio support
: - authentication by smartcard and USB stick
:
: X2Go Desktop Sharing is an X2Go add-on feature that allows a user to
: grant other X2Go users access to the current session (shadow session
: support). The user's current session may be an X2Go session itself or
: simply a local X11 session.
:
: This package contains all the integration and configuration logics
: of a system-wide manageable desktop sharing setup.
